    The song was first released by Frankie Ford in 1959, sung over Smith's original backing track. On the Billboard charts, it reached number 14 in the Hot 100 and number 11 on the Hot R&B Sides . [3] Released on Ace Records, it sold over one million copies, gaining gold disc status. [2]
